Add 3/6 and 60/32
1st number: 3/6, 2nd number: 1 28/32
3/6 + 60/32 is 19/8.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 6 and 32 is 96
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 96 - For the 1st fraction, since 6 × 16 = 96,
3/6 = 3 × 16/6 × 16 = 48/96 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 32 × 3 = 96,
60/32 = 60 × 3/32 × 3 = 180/96 - Add the two like fractions:
48/96 + 180/96 = 48 + 180/96 = 228/96 - 228/96 simplified gives 19/8
- So, 3/6 + 60/32 = 19/8
